The number 17,31 and 73 are prime numbers reversing the order of the digits to make 71,13 and 37 are also result in prime number

s does reversing the order of the digits of a two digit prime number always result in a prime number explain

Answer:

No

Step-by-step explanation:

take the example of 19. it is a prime number but when flipped gives 91, divisible by 7 and 13, therefore not prime. The examples in the question were just carefully selected to be true.
